Kathmandu to Pokhara Flight Tour Facts
-
Kathmandu to Pokhara Flight Distance: Approximately 200 kilometres (124 miles).
-
Kathmandu to Pokhara Flight Duration: Around 25-30 minutes.
-
Best Season: Autumn (September-November) and Spring (March-May) for clear mountain views.
-
Airlines Operating: Buddha Air, Yeti Airlines, and Shree Airlines.
-
Kathmandu- Pokhara Baggage Allowance: Lightweight 15 kg checked baggage and/or 5 kg hand baggage (airline dependent).
-
Pokhara Elevation: 822 meters (2,697 feet) above sea level.
-
Kathmandu Elevation: 1,400 meters (4,593 feet) above sea level.
-
Tour Duration: 5 days (includes Kathmandu sightseeing and Pokhara exploration).
-
Popular Attractions: Pashupatinath, Boudhanath, Swayambhunath, Phewa Lake, Davis Falls, and Sarangkot.
-
Suitable For: Families, couples, solo travellers, and adventure seekers.

Detailed Itinerary
Day 01 Arrival in Kathmandu & Visit to Pashupatinath and Guheswari
Our agent will meet you upon arrival at Kathmandu Tribhuvan International Airport, after check-in at the hotel and the chance to sleep.
The Kathmandu to Pokhara Flight tour of 5 days begins with a visit to the historic Pashupatinath Temple, one of the UNESCO World Heritage sites and a holy temple of Lord Shiva in honour of Lord Shiva.
You'll witness the temple's intricate architecture and rituals conducted on the banks of the Bagmati River. The following is the subject to be treated: the Guheswari Temple, another significant pilgrimage site in Shakti.
Once you are done, you can lounge and stroll around the local market, chill at the hotel, or do something else.

Day 02 Full-Day Sightseeing in Kathmandu
Start the day with a typical large breakfast, then go on a sightseeing trip around Kathmandu all day.
Visit the impressive Boudhanath Stupa, one of the world's great spherical stupas, and experience the serenity of Buddhist thought through a moment of meditative beauty.
Subsequently, visit the historic Swayambhunath Stupa (monkey temple) on top of a hill, which offers a panoramic cityscape view.
Next is Kathmandu Durbar Square, a historical palace complex with wonderful arts and courtyards that exemplify Nepal's rich cultural pride.
At night, walk in Thamel, the bustling street packed with shops, restaurants, and tea houses.

Frequently Asked Questions
1. How many flights operate daily between Kathmandu and Pokhara?
The number of flights per day varies from 20-25 (season and demand dependent).
2. Are there any direct international flights to Pokhara?
Currently, Pokhara Airport is not limited to domestic flights; Pokhara Regional International Airport will also handle flights from foreign airlines.
3. Is it safe to fly from Kathmandu to Pokhara?
Yes, the flight is safe with Nepali Airlines, which has great experience in flying over the mountains. Pilots are well-trained for such routes.
4. Can the Kathmandu-Pokhara tour package be booked at the last minute?
Yes, it is recommended to book in advance, especially during the peak tourist season, because there are a limited number of flights and hotels.
5. What is the cost of the Kathmandu-Pokhara flight?
Return flights cost between US $100 and US $125, although the exact price depends on the airline and the time of year.
6. Are adventure activities like Pokhara available for the tour?
While the usual activity is sightseeing, there are some optional adventure activities, such as paragliding, ziplining, or ultralight flights, available in Pokhara.
7. What is the food like during the Kathmandu Pokhara Flight Tour?
Kathmandu and Pokhara have a wide variety of Nepali, Indian, and continental dishes. Popular dishes include dal bhat, momo, and Newari specialties.
8. Do I need a visa for this tour?
Yes, most travellers require a visa to enter Nepal. On-arrival visas are available to most nationalities at the Kathmandu Tribhuvan airport.

10. What cultural etiquette should I follow during the tour?
Always say "Namaste" to the local people, dress conservatively, and especially do not wear inappropriate clothing for religious places. Do not step over or touch any item of worship with your feet. Respect local customs for a more immersive experience.
